The Center for Quality Engineering of SGS Germany GmbH is accredited by DATech for COMPONENTS TESTING ENVIRONMENTAL ENGINEERING ELECTROMAGNETIC COMPATIBILITY PRODUCT SAFETY TELECOM CONFORMANCE TESTS SGS Germany GmbH, SGS CQE, Hofmannstr. 50, D-81379 München, Phone +49 89-787475-130, Fax +49 89-787475-122, Internet www.sgs-cqe.de The test report shall not be reproduced except in full without the written approval of the testing laboratory Center for Quality Engineering Evaluation No.: D0QJ0001 Order No.: D0QJ Pages: 13 Munich, Jun 19, 2010 Client: Nokia Siemens Networks Oy Equipment Under Test: Flexi WCDMA Base Station with antenna types:  HBX-6516DS-VTM  CS7278001 Manufacturer: Nokia Siemens Networks Oy Task: Identification of compliance with the requirements FCC 47 CFR § 1.1310 on base of  Test Specification(s):  OET Bulletin 65  Draft IEC 62232 Ed.1.0 Result: The EUT meets the above cited requirements The results relate only to the items tested as described in this test report. edited by: Date Signature Rieb Qualification Engineer Jun 19, 2010 approved by: Date Signature Bauer Manager EMC Jun 19, 2010 Evaluation No.: D0QJ0001 Date: Jun 19, 2010 WCDMA Base Station page 2 / 13 The test report shall not be reproduced except in full without the written approval of the testing laboratory CONTENTS 1 Summary ..................................................................................................................................3 2 References ...............................................................................................................................4 2.1 Specifications ......................................................................................................................4 2.2 Glossary of Terms...............................................................................................................4 3 General Information ................................................................................................................5 3.1 Identification of Client..........................................................................................................5 3.2 Test Laboratory ...................................................................................................................5 3.3 Participants .........................................................................................................................5 4 Equipment Under Test ............................................................................................................6 4.1 TYPICAL CONFIGURATION ..............................................................................................6 4.2 WHEN USING DIFFERENT CONFIGURATIONS ..............................................................7 5 Evaluation of the EUT .............................................................................................................8 5.1 Definition of compliance boundary ......................................................................................8 5.2 Assessment of compliance boundary .................................................................................8 ANNEX A: Exposure limits .......................................................................................................11 ANNEX B: Far-Field Calculation Method.................................................................................11 Annex C: Safety for Public and Workers ................................................................................12 Evaluation No.: D0QJ0001 Date: Jun 19, 2010 WCDMA Base Station page 3 / 13 The test report shall not be reproduced except in full without the written approval of the testing laboratory 1 Summary This evaluation is based on numerical calculations to demonstrate the compliance of “Flexi WCDMA BTS” with the maximum permissible exposure limits for general population and occupation to radio frequency electromagnetic fields with respect to FCC 47 CFR §1.1310 [1] (see Annex A). The compliance is shown via the concept of compliance boundary of the antenna as described in section 4.2. The detailed results are shown in Table 4 of section 4. The “Flexi WCDMA BTS” is compliant with the exposure limits of FCC 47 CFR §1.1310 for general population and occupation to radio frequency electromagnetic fields at every point outside the compliance boundary. Provisions have to be taken to guarantee that no public access is possible to regions within the compliance boundaries for general population. For workers adequate warnings and information have to be provided for entering the exclusion area (see Annex C). RESULT RF Power Output 25.252/DA 10-60 32.0 dBW EIRP Complies RF Power Output 25.252 32.1 dBW/4 MHz EIRP Complies 99% Occupied Bandwidth 2.1049 (i) Unspecified Complies Spurious Emissions at Antenna Terminals 25.252 2.1051 -87.6 dBm/4kHz -13 dBm Complies Field Strength of Spurious Emissions 25.252 2.1053 -70.6 dBm/4kHz EIRP -13 dBm EIRP Complies Frequency stability 25.252, 2.1055 ± 0.05 ppm 1) Complies Note 1) Limit is the manufacturer’s specification Measurement uncertainty is expressed to a confidence level of 95%. FCC ID: - Type: FRJA FCC PART 25.252 Test report No.: 106205A Page 5 (54) Date 01.06.2010 2. General Equipment Specification Supply Voltage Input: Frequency Bands: TX: Frequency Bands: RX: Type of Modulation and Designator: Maximum No. of Carriers: Output Impedance: RF Output: Band Selection: 48 Vdc 2180 – 2200 MHz Lowest tunable freq. 2185.000 MHz Middle freq. 2190.000 MHz Highest tunable freq. 2195.000 MHz 2000 – 2020 MHz W-CDMA GSM NADC (4M00F9W) (200KG7W) 40K0DXW) 1 50 ohms. Per channel: 20 W. Grant Notes
Output power is EIRP for Part 25. Device is a dual mode mobile terminal - 2000-2010 MHz frequency band for MSS uplinks and ATC mobile-to-base transmissions - 2190-2200 MHz band for reception of MSS downlinks and ATC base-to-mobile transmissions. Part 25 ATC function must operate pursuant to FCC- DA 10-60. The antenna(s) used for this transmitter must be installed to provide a separation described in this filing. Users and installers must be provided with antenna installation instructions and transmitter operating conditions for satisfying RF exposure compliance. This device must be professionally installed.
